The third part of the Turok saga (Turok 3 was the fourth), followed the Bit Managers had started under the auspices of Acclaim: impeccable technical aspects, great playability and almost guaranteed commercial success.

As a novelty, the stages were deeper and you could move more freely from top to bottom in levels with horizontal scrolling. But there were also levels where development was vertical.

It was the first to be made exclusively for the Game Boy Color (the first part had appeared on the original console, while the second was a cartridge that worked on both handhelds).
